Classic Chocolate Brownies

Decadent Chocolate Mousse

Indulge your sweet tooth with this delightful and rich chocolate mousse recipe. Perfect for a special occasion or just a simple dessert to satisfy your cravings, this decadent treat is sure to impress your friends and family.

This mini tower of chocolate goodness will transport you back to being a kid, enjoying chocolate in all its forms. The fudgy and creamy texture of the mousse is simply irresistible, and the rich chocolate flavor will leave you wanting more.

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 8 ounces semisweet chocolate, coarsely chopped
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 4 large eggs, separated
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• Pinch of salt

Instructions:

  1. In a saucepan, heat the heavy cream until it starts to steam. Remove from heat and stir in the chocolate and butter until smooth and melted.
  2. In a separate bowl, whisk together the egg yolks, sugar, vanilla extract, and salt until well combined.
  3. Slowly pour the chocolate mixture into the egg yolk mixture, whisking constantly to prevent the eggs from cooking.
  4. In another bowl, beat the egg whites until stiff peaks form.
  5. Gently fold the beaten egg whites into the chocolate mixture until well incorporated.
  6. Divide the mousse into individual serving glasses or bowls and refrigerate for at least 4 hours, or until set.
  7. Serve chilled and garnish with whipped cream or chocolate shavings, if desired.

Sinful Chocolate Peanut Butter Cups

If you love the combination of rich chocolate and creamy peanut butter, then these Sinful Chocolate Peanut Butter Cups are the perfect treat for you. Indulge your sweet tooth with these luscious dessert cups that will surely have you drooling!

To prepare this delightful dessert, you’ll need the following ingredients:

1 cup chocolate chips 1 cup peanut butter ¼ cup powdered sugar ¼ cup butter, melted

Start by melting the chocolate chips in a microwave-safe bowl. Stir the chips every 20 seconds until smooth and creamy. In a separate bowl, mix the peanut butter, powdered sugar, and melted butter until well combined.

Next, line a cupcake pan with cupcake liners. Pour a tablespoon of the melted chocolate into each cupcake liner, spreading it around the bottom and up the sides. Freeze the chocolate cups for 5-10 minutes to set.

Once the chocolate has set, take the pan out of the freezer and spoon a tablespoon of the peanut butter mixture into each cup. Flatten the mixture slightly with the back of a spoon. Top each cup with another tablespoon of melted chocolate, spreading it to cover the peanut butter filling.

Refrigerate the peanut butter cups for at least 30 minutes to allow them to fully set. Once they are firm, remove them from the cupcake pan and enjoy! These sinfully delicious treats can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a week.

Classic Chocolate Chip Cookies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up butter, soft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 cups semisweet chocolate chips

Inst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, cream together the but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y.
  3. Add the eggs, one at a time, and mix well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la extract.
  4. In a separate bowl, combine the flour, baking soda, and salt. Gradually add the dry mixture to the butter mixture, mixing until just combined.
  5. Gently fold in the chocolate chips.
  6. Drop rounded tablespoons of dough onto the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art.
  7. Bake for 8-10 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own. Let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es, then transfer them to a wire rack to cool completely.

Eggless Chocolate Chip Cookies Recipe

If you’re looking for an eggless option, this recipe is for you.

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up butter, soft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 cups semisweet chocolate chips

Inst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, cream together the but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y.
  3. Stir in the milk and vanilla extract.
  4. In a separate bowl, combine the flour, baking soda, and salt. Gradually add the dry mixture to the butter mixture, mixing until just combined.
  5. Gently fold in the chocolate chips.
  6. Drop rounded tablespoons of dough onto the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art.
  7. Bake for 8-10 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own. Let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es, then transfer them to a wire rack to cool completely.

Delightful Chocolate Covered Strawberries

If you love chocolate and strawberries, then you will absolutely adore chocolate covered strawberries. They are a simple yet rich dessert that can be enjoyed on its own or as a delightful addition to other treats. The combination of sweet, juicy strawberries and smooth, chocolaty coating is simply irresistible.

To make chocolate covered strawberries, start by preparing your strawberries. Wash them well and pat them dry with a paper towel. Make sure to pick ripe strawberries so they are sweet and flavorful. You can also use larger strawberries if you prefer.

Next, melt some chocolate. You can use dark, milk, or white chocolate, depending on your preference. Chop the chocolate into small, even pieces and place them in a microwave-safe bowl. Microwave the chocolate in 30-second intervals, stirring after each interval, until it is completely melted and smooth.

Dip the strawberries into the melted chocolate. You can use a fork or a toothpick to hold the strawberry and immerse it in the chocolate. Coat the strawberry fully with the chocolate, leaving only a small part uncovered at the top to create a beautiful display. You can also sprinkle some chopped nuts, like walnuts, on top of the chocolate for added texture and flavor.

Place the chocolate covered strawberries on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Let them cool and set for about 20 minutes, or until the chocolate hardens. You can also place them in the refrigerator for a quicker setting process.
